Medical attendant vs attendant

The differences between medical attendants and attendants can be seen in a few details. Each job has different responsibilities and duties. Additionally, a medical attendant has an average salary of $32,495, which is higher than the $27,453 average annual salary of an attendant.

The top three skills for a medical attendant include patients, vital signs and patient care. The most important skills for an attendant are cleanliness, customer service, and home health.
